Quick Q about the Unity 5.x schema updates. The existing setup has Exchange 2003 UM with Unity 4.0.5 and CCM 4.1.3.

The exchange environment is being upgraded and so there are Exchange 2003 and Exchange 2007 servers in the domain. The Ex3k users will be migrated over to Ex07 in one hit, but initially they are co-residing for testing the migration.

I'll be installing CCM 5.x and Unity 5.x Unified Messaging as a clean install - no DiRT or BARS due to various factors, starting installs from fresh (it's not a huge site - 300 odd users).

I'd just like confirmation that running the Unity 5.x schema updates 1) will not impact the existing Uty 4.0.5 install and 2) will not impact the existing Windows/Exchange 03+07 boxes?

Has anyone had any issues with this at all? I've done loads of 4.x UM installs, but this is the 1st I've done with Exchange 03 + 07 and the 1st Uty 5.x.

As a side, I've heard mid-August for the UK English language - I guess this'll be an update setup process rather than a complete uninstall & re-install?

Hi NJ -

Installed in lab, not production yet. Have both Exchange 2003 and 2007 in our lab environment. There was no impact to running the 5.0 schema updates in this environment. We had test Unity subscribers on both information stores as well during the test.

I ran the Unity 5.x schema updates in a W2K3/E2K3/Unity4.0(5) environment some time before installing Unity 5.x. I had no problems. I then ran 4.0(5) and 5.x digitally networked for several weeks with no problems. I havent' had Exchange 2007 experience yet, but as Unity 5.x supports 07, I can't imaging that the schema updates will cause any issues there.
